Fees and Cost Over Time

NETG charges 0.75% per year while VYM charges 0.04%. On a $10,000 position that is $75 vs $4 annually, a gap of $71 per year that compounds over a long holding period. On income, NETG currently yields 0.00% against 2.24% for VYM.
